Hello , i would like to have couple of informations about the " resistor and circuit breaker assy-ignition"( 01a 12250)
What does it look like , are the 2 parts integrated in a same assy,caracteristics of the c/b and resistor,is it a specific part for the gp?

Re: resistor and circuit breaker assy-ignition
There are two parts riveted to a piece of hard rubber. I don't have any good pics of mine, but if you google it you will see. It is not a GP specific part

Re: resistor and circuit breaker assy-ignition
Joe,
This part is standard off the shelf for 1940 (and up) V-8 Auto.
Just order it by the part number....O1A-12250.
